#### Adding an App-V package
Adding an App-V package to the client is the first step of the publishing refresh process. The end result is the same as the `Add-AppVClientPackage` cmdlet in Windows PowerShell, except during the publishing refresh add process, the configured publishing server is contacted and passes a high-level list of applications back to the client to pull more detailed information and not a single package add operation. The process continues by configuring the client for package or connection group additions or updates, then accesses the appv file. Next, the contents of the appv file are expanded and placed on the local operating system in the appropriate locations. The following is a detailed workflow of the process, assuming the package is configured for Fault Streaming.

### Upgrading an App-V package
The App-V package upgrade process differs from the older versions of App-V. App-V supports multiple versions of the same package on a machine entitled to different users. Package versions can be added at any time as the package store and catalogs are updated with the new resources. The only process specific to the addition of new version resources is storage optimization. During an upgrade, only the new files are added to the new version store location and hard links are created for unchanged files. This reduces the overall storage by only presenting the file on one disk location and then projecting it into all folders with a file location entry on the disk. The specific details of upgrading an App-V Package are as follows:

### Global vs. user publishing
App-V Packages can be published in one of two ways; User which entitles an App-V package to a specific user or group of users and Global which entitles the App-V package to the entire machine for all users of the machine. Once a package upgrade has been pended and the App-V package is not in use, consider the two types of publishing:

- **Globally published**: the application is published to a machine; all users on that machine can use it. The upgrade will happen when the App-V Client Service starts, which effectively means a machine restart.
- **User published**: the application is published to a user. If there are multiple users on the machine, the application can be published to a subset of the users. The upgrade will happen when the user logs in or when it is published again (periodically, ConfigMgr Policy refresh and evaluation, or an App-V periodic publishing/refresh, or explicitly via Windows PowerShell commands).
